When your project defers structural items to the submittal phase, I provide the stamped calculation packages that get them approved — designed to current CBC 2022, AISC 360-22, ASCE 7-22, NDS 2021, and ACI 318-19, and ready for plan check and fabrication.
I've practiced civil engineering in California for more than 34 years, and my stamp has gone on everything from full subdivision improvement plans to single-detail steel calculations. That range is the point: whether you're a fabricator who needs stamped calcs for a stair package or a developer taking raw land through entitlement, you work directly with the engineer of record — not a project manager relaying questions to one.
The core of my practice is general land development: site design, grading and drainage, water and sewer, entitlements, and permitting for residential, retail, commercial, and industrial projects across the region — including more than 80 automatic gate and fence engineering projects. I also provide stamped structural calculations for deferred submittals: guardrails, stairs, ladders, gates, and the framing and connections that hold them up, calculated detail by detail against the current California Building Code so plan checkers get complete coverage the first time.
I keep the practice deliberately small. You get direct answers, fast turnaround, and documents that hold up in plan check.
